Abstract

Aim To investigate effects of angelica A3 active component ( A3 ) on cyclooxygenase-2 ( COX-2 ) activity and expression in lipopolysaccharide ( LPS )-induced mouse RAW264. 7 macrophage cells. Methods Prostaglandin E2( PGE2 ) production and COX-2 enzyme activity were investigated by enzyme-line Im-munosorbnent assay ( ELISA ). RT-PCR and Western blot were used to analyze cyclooxygenase-2 mRNA and the protein expression level. Results A3 20,40, 80mg ? L * was shown to markedly inhibit the LPS-in-duced PGE2 production, COX-2 enzyme activity, COX-2 mRNA and protein expression in RAW264. 7 cells ( P < 0.05 ). Conclusion A3 can directly decrease PGE2 production, which may be related to inhibiting COX-2 gene expression.
